Устройство для отображения информации на экране электронно-лучевой трубки Советский патент 1983 года по МПК G09G1/08 

Описание патента на изобретение SU1005170A1

(54) УСТРОЙСТВО ДЛЯ ОТОБРАЖЕНИЯ ИНФОРМАЦИИ НА ЭКРАНЕ ЭЛЕКТРОННО-ЛУЧЕВОЙ ТРУБКИ

Похожие патенты SU1005170A1

название год авторы номер документа
Устройство для формирования символов 1983
  • Козловский Николай Петрович
SU1113840A1
Устройство для отображения информации 1981
  • Козловский Николай Петрович
SU963080A1
Устройство для отображения информации 1978
  • Козловский Николай Петрович
SU746629A1
Устройство для отображения информации 1977
  • Козловский Николай Петрович
SU711602A1
Устройство для отображения информации 1979
  • Козловский Николай Петрович
SU868822A2
Устройство для формирования символов на экране электронно-лучевой трубки 1981
  • Козловский Николай Петрович
SU1001160A1
Устройство для отображения информации 1985
  • Козловский Николай Петрович
SU1316028A2
Устройство для формирования символов 1983
  • Козловский Николай Петрович
SU1088060A1
Устройство для формирования символов 1980
  • Козловский Николай Петрович
  • Кравченко Иван Адамович
  • Ким Виктор Иванович
SU934540A1
Устройство для отображения информации 1980
  • Козловский Николай Петрович
SU943700A1

Иллюстрации к изобретению SU 1 005 170 A1

Реферат патента 1983 года Устройство для отображения информации на экране электронно-лучевой трубки

Формула изобретения SU 1 005 170 A1

1

Изобретение относктся к автоматике и вычислительной технике и может быть использовано при построении устройств для формирования символов на экране электронно-лучевой трубки (ЭЛТ). Известно устройство для отображения информации, содержащее генератор импульсов, формирователь импульсов синхронизации, блок-памяти символов;,.счетчик адреса, логический блок, преобразователь код - время, регистр микрокоманд, генератор функциональных напряжений, блок подсвета луча, делитель частоты, два триггера, мультивибратор, блок выделения элементов символа 1.

Недостатком этого устройства является то, что оно позволяет отображать только те символы, для которых задана программа в его блоке памяти.

Наиболее близким к предлагаемому по технической сущности является устройство для отображения информации, содержащее блок памяти, соединенный с регистром, генератор функциональных напряжений, подключенный к регистру, преобразователь код - время, соединенный с генератором импульСОВ, регистром, подключенным к блоку подсвета луча, счетчик адреса, логический блок и формирователь импульсов, соединенный с генератором импульсов, преобразователем код - время, генератором функциональных напряжений, блоком памяти, счетчиком адреса и логическим блоком, подключенным к блоку памяти и счетчику адреса, соединенному с преобразователем код- время и блоком памяти 2.

Недостатком этого устройства является то, что в нем отображаются только символы, хранящиеся в его блоке памяти.

Цель,изобретения - повышение информативности отображаемой информации {за счет отображения одного и того же символа, хранящегося в памяти, различного вида, линиями, например сплошной, пунктирной, штриховой и т.п.).

Поставленная цель достигается тем, что в устройство, содержащее последовательно соединенные блок элементов 2И-ИЛИ, счет чик адреса, блок памяти, регистр и генератор напряжений развертки, соединенный с отклоняющими системами ЭЛТ, последовательно соединенные . генератор импульсов, синхронизатор и преобразователь код - время и блок подсвета, подключенный к модулятору ЭЛТ, выходы синхронизатора соединены с блоком элементов 2И-ИЛИ, счетчиком адреса, блоком памяти, преобразователем код - время и генератором напряжений развертки, выходы преобразователя код- время соединены с синхронизатором и регистром, введены последовательно соединенные делитель частоты, формирователь длительности импульса иэлемент 2И-ИЛИ и триггер, вход делителя частоты соединен с генератором импульсов, выход элемента 2И-ИЛИ соединен с блоком подсвета, а входы элемента 2И - ИЛИ соединены с выходами регистра и триггера соответственно, входы триггера и делителя частоты соединены с выходами синхронизатора.

На фиг. 1 приведена структурная схема устройства; на фиг. 2 - вид формируемых символов; на фиг. 3 - структурная схема блока элементов 2И - ИЛИ; на фиг. 4 - структурная схема синхронизатора.

Устройство содержит генератор 1 импульсов, синхронизатор 2, блок 3 элементов 2И - ИЛИ, счетчик 4 адреса, блок 5 памяти, преобразователь 6 код-время, регистр 7, генератор 8 напряжений развертки, блок 9 подсвета, делитель 10 частоты (управляемый), формирователь 11 длительности импульсов, триггер 12, элемент 13 2И-ИЛИ, входы и выходы 14-21 устройства соответственно, распределитель 22 импульсов, формирователь 23 сигнала конца символа, формирователь 24 двухтактных импульсов формирователь 25 сигнала обращения, триггер 26 и элементы 27 и 28 2И--ИЛИ.

Генератор 1 импульсов управляющим входом подключен к входу 15 синхронизации, входом установки в нуль соединен с входами установки в нуль триггера 12, преобразователя 6 код-время, делителя 10 частоты, шестым выходом синхронизатора и выходом 21 устройства, выход генератора 1 подк,лючен к первому входу синхронизатора 2, первый выход которого,соединен с управляющим входо.м блока 3 элемептов 2И-ИЛИ, выход которого подключен к информационному входу счетчика 4 адреса, вход сброса которого соединен с вторым выходо.м синхронизатора 2, а выход подключен к адресному входу блока 5 памяти, третий, четвертый и пятый выходы синхронизатора 2 соединены с синхровходами блока 5 памяти, генератора 8 развертки и преобразователя 6 код- время соответственно, второй вход синхронизатора соединен со счетным входом счетчика 4 адреса, управляющим входом регистра 7 и выходом преобразователя 6 код- время, информационный вход которого соединен с информационными входами синхронизатора 2, регистра 7, выходом блока 5 памяти и вторым информационным входом блока 3 элементов 2И-ИЛИ, первый информационный вход которого является первым информационным входом 14 устройства, выход регистра 7 соединен с информационным входом генератора 8 развертки, третьим и четвертым входами элемента 13 2И-ИЛИ, выход которого подключен к входу блока 9 подсвета, второй и пятый выходы элемента 13 2И-ИЛИ соединены с первым и вторым выходами триггера 12 соответственно, а первый вход - с выходом формирователя 11 длительности импульсов, второй вход которого соединен с выходом делителя 10 частоты, второй вход которого подключен к выходу генератора 1 импульсов, первые входы делителя 10 частоты, формирователя 11 длительности и.мпульсов и триггера 12 являются входами 16-18 устройства,, выход 19 устройства является выходом генератора 8 развертки, а выход 20 устройства является выходом блока 9 подсвета луча.

Генератор 1 импульсов предназначен для формирования пачки тактовых импульсов, необходимых для работы синхронизатора 2.

Синхронизатор 2 предназначен для формирования сигналов синхронизации и управления между блоками устройства. Техническая реализация его может быть осуществлена по структурной схеме, приведенной на фиг. 4.

Блок 3 элементов 2И-ИЛИ является коммутатором информации с двух направлений и предназначен для коммутации кода символа с входа 14 устройства или кода начального адреса с выхода блока 5 памяти. Техническая реализация его может быть выполнена на элементах 2И-ИЛИ по структурной схеме, приведенной на фиг. 3.

Счетчик 4 адреса предназначен для управления кодом адреса на входе блока 5 памяти, который предназначен для записи и хранения кодов начальных адресов и кодов векторов символа.

Преобразователь 6 код-время предназначен для формирования сигналов конца вектора символа. Техническая реализация его может быть осуществлена на базе микросхем 133 (155) ИЕ7 в режи.ме вычитания.

Регистр 7 предназначен для записи и хранения кодов векторов символа на время их формирования, генератор 8 развертки - для формирования функциональных напряжений развертки символа по координатам X и У.

Блок 9 подсвета предназначен для формирования сигналов подсвета векторов контура символа, необходимых для его изображения на экране ЭЛТ.

Делитель 10 частоты используется для изменения тактовой частоты на его выходе по внешнему коду управления. Техническая реализация его может быть осуществлена, например, на базе микросхем 133 (155) ИЕ8.

Формирователь 11 длительности импульсов предназначен для формирования сигналов подсвета векторов символа по длительности.

Устройство работает следующим образом.

Код символа с входа 14 устройства поступает на первый информационный вход блока 3 элементов 2И-ИЛИ, а по входу 15 импульсом синхронизации запускается стартстопный генератор 1 импульсов. С выхода генератора 1 пачка тактовых импульсов поступает на первый вход синхронизатора 2, который на первом выходе формирует сигнал разрешения записи кода символа через блок 3 элементов 2И-ИЛИ в счетчик 4 адреса, а на третьем выходе сигнал обращения к блоку 5 памяти. Записанный код символа в счетчик 4 является адресом для выбора кода начального адреса микропрограммы символа из блока 5 памяти.

Микропрограмма символа состоит из кода начального адреса, кодов векторов и кода конца символа. Каждому входному коду символа соответствует свой код начального .адреса, который является адресом кода первого вектора символа.

Выбранный код начального адреса из блока 5 памяти хранится в его выходном регистре (не показан). После выборки кода начального адреса из блока 5 памяти счетчик 4 адреса устанавливается в нуль сигналом сброса со второго выхода синхрони-., затора, который на первом выходе формирует сигнал разрешения записи кода начального адреса через блок 3 элементов 2И- ИЛИ в счетчик 4, а на третьем выходе второй сигнал обращения к блоку 5 памяти.

По коду начального адреса и второму обращению на выходе блока 5 памяти формируется код первого вектора символа, который имеет следующую структуру: 6 разрядов для управления разверткой вектора по координатам X-и У, 3 разряда для задания длины вектора и 1 разряд для формирования сигналов подсвета.

После выборки кода первого вектора символа с блока 5 памяти с пятого выхода синхронизатора 2 начинают поступать тактовые импульсы на синхровход преобразователя 6 код-время, а на его информационный вход - 3-разрядный код длины вектора с выхода блока 5 памяти.

В начальный момент времени на выходе преобразователя 6 код-время формируется сигнал конца вектора (СКВ), соответствующий вектору нулевой длины. По этому сигналу в преобразователь 6 код-время вводится код длины вектора, а в регистр 7 код развертки и подсвета символа.

Одновременно этот сигнал поступает на счетный вход счетчика 4 адреса и увеличивает его состояние на единицу. Кроме того, по этому сигналу на четверто.м вьгходе синхронизатора формируется сигнал разрешения работы генератора развертки 8, а на третьем выходе очередной сигнал обращения к блоку 5 памяти.

По измененному коду начального адреса и новому обращению на выходе блока 5 памяти формируется код второго вектора символа, который хранится в его выходном регистре.

С момента записи кода первого вектора в регистр 7 и преобразователь 6 код-время

генератор 8 развертки символа формирует напряжения развертки по координатам X и Y, преобразователь 6 код-время задает длину вектора, а блок 9 подсвета определяет яркость луча ЭеПТ.

После окончания формирования первого

0 вектора символа на выходе преобразовате, ля 6 код-время формируется сигнал СКВ с. временным интервалом, пропорциональным частоте тактовых импульсов на синхровходе и 3-разрядному коду на информацион5 ном входе. Этим сигналом код второго вектора символа с выходного регистра блока 5 памяти вводится в регистр 7 и преобразователь 6 код-время. С этого момента времени генератор 8 развертки формирует напряжения развертки второго вектора симво0ла по координатам X и Y, а преобразователь 6 код-время задает его длину.

Аналогично формируются все последующие векторы, составляющие фигуру символа. При формировании последнего вектора

5 симво)1а на выходе блока 5 памяти формируется выходное число, содержащее нули во всех разрядах. Три разряда этого числа поступают на информационный вход синхронизатора 2, который по этому коду и последнему СКВ формирует сигнал конца символа. Этот сигнал приводит устройство в исходное состояние и поступает на выход 21 устройства для вызова кода следующего символа из внешнего устройства управления (не показано).

5 Одновременно с кодом символа на вход 16 устройства поступает признак типа линии отображаемого символа, на вход 17 - код длины штриха, на вход 18 - код интервала между штрихами.

При нулевом уровне на входе 16 устрой ства на втором выходе триггера 12 устанавливается уровень логической единицы, который разрешает прохождение сигналов подсвета с четвертого входа элемента 13 2И- ИЛИ на его выход. При этом на вход бло5 ка 9 подсвета поступают сигналы подсвета с длительностью, равной временному интервалу между импульсами СКВ. В этом случае символ на экране ЭЛТ отображается непрерывными отрезками прямых линий, подсвет которых определяется только кодом подсвета с выхода блока 5 памяти (фиг. 2, вариант I).

При поступлении на вход 16 устройства признака линии (сигнал логической единицы) триггер 12 устанавливается в единичное

состояние. Уровень логической единицы на его первом выходе разрешает прохождение сигналов подсвета с третьего входа элемента 13 2И-ИЛИ на его выход. При этом на выходе элемента 13 импульсы подсвета модулированы по длительности импульсами, поступающими на его первый вход с выхода формирователя 11 длительности импульсов, а символ отображается Штриховой линией, длина штрихов которой определяется длительностью импульсов на выходе формирователя 11.

Управление длительностью выходных импульсов формирователя 11 производится кодом на входе 17 устройства, а его запуск - импульсами с выхода управляемого делителя 10 частоты, который изменяет свою частоту по коду на входе 18 устройства. Частота на выходе делителя 10 определяет интервал между началами двух соседних штрихов, т.е. их шаг.

Задавая в определенных комбинациях коды на входах 16-18 устройства, можно изменять вид любого символа, записанного в блок 5 памяти.

Например, если необходимо отобразить символ точками (фиг. 2, вариант II), то на вход 16 устройства подается логическая единица, на вход 17 - код, соответствующий минимальной длительности выходных импульсов формирователя 11, на вход 18 - код, определяющий необходимое расстояние между точками.

Аналогично для отображения символов, штриховой линией (фиг. 2, вариант III) на вход 16 устройства подается логическая единица, на вход 17 - код длины штриха, на вход 18 - код интервала между штрихами. Формула изобретения

Устройство для отображения информации на экране электронно-лучевой трубки.

содержашее последовательно соединенные блок элементов , счетчик адреса, блок памяти, регистр и генератор напряжений развертки, соединенный с отклоняющими системами электронно-лучевой трубки,

последовательно соединенные генератор импульсов, синхронизатор и преобразователь код-время и блок подсвета, подключенный к модулятору электронно-лучевой трубки, выходы синхронизатора соединены с блоком элементов 2И-ИЛИ, счетчиком адреса, блоком памяти, преобразователем код-время и генератором напряжений развертки, выходы преобразователя код-время соединены с синхронизатором и регистром, отличающееся тем, что, с целью повышения информативности отображаемой информации, оно содержит последовательно соединенные делитель частоты, формирователь длительности импульса и элемент 2И-ИЛИ и триггер, вход делителя частоты соединен с генератором импульсов, выход элемента 2И-ИЛИ соединен с блоком подсвета, а входы элемента 2И-ИЛИ соединены с выходами регистра и триггера соответственно, входы триггера и делителя частоты соединены с выходами синхронизатора.

Источники информации, принятые во внимание при экспертизе

1.Авторское свидетельство СССР 711602, кл. G 06 К 15/20, 1980.2.Авторское свидетельство СССР

634322, кл. G 06 К 15/20, 1978 (прототип).

Гn

,n

SU 1 005 170 A1

Авторы

Козловский Николай Петрович

Даты

1983-03-15Публикация

1981-10-23Подача